From fe5e3d1915e2aeb809b367b413dbe07f5a5ac450 Mon Sep 17 00:00:00 2001 From: rUv Date: Sat, 7 Jun 2025 13:59:41 +0000 Subject: [PATCH] fix: Remove poolclass specification for async engine creation --- src/database/connection.py | 3 +-- 1 file changed, 1 insertion(+), 2 deletions(-) diff --git a/src/database/connection.py b/src/database/connection.py index 84fbed9..3c367d1 100644 --- a/src/database/connection.py +++ b/src/database/connection.py @@ -80,10 +80,9 @@ class DatabaseManager: f"@{self.settings.db_host}:{self.settings.db_port}/{self.settings.db_name}" ) - # Create async engine + # Create async engine (don't specify poolclass for async engines) self._async_engine = create_async_engine( async_db_url, - poolclass=QueuePool, pool_size=self._connection_pool_size, max_overflow=self._max_overflow, pool_timeout=self._pool_timeout,